Dual Degree: BSHS in Clinical Operations and Health Care Management / MSHS in Health Care Quality- Curriculum
Curriculum Details
147 TOTAL CREDITS REQUIRED
In coursework for the dual BSHS in Clinical Operations and Health Care Management / MSHS in Health Care Quality, you’ll study the delivery of health care services while focusing on key operational activities such as clinical decision-making, finance, human resources, informatics, marketing, policy, qualify, and safety.
You can complete this degree program in four to five years, and prepare for several industry-relevant certifications.
BSHS
Theory and application of management and leadership as they affect the management of human resources in health sciences organizations. Focus is on leadership, ethics, and organizational dynamics in a changing health care environment.
The goal of the course is to enable learners to propose and analyze multi-dimensional solutions that address complex issues encountered in the management and leadership of health sciences clinical enterprises.
Introduction to key finance competencies necessary for clinical and healthcare operations; costs, expenditure, and reimbursement of services.
Skills needed by health care leadership to promote services and strategic change; theory and application of marketing principles for the purpose of project planning, organizational growth, and public relations.
Overview of health communication research, theory, and practice, examining the powerful communication influences on delivering care and health promotion.
Builds on prior coursework to apply clinical operations and health care management practices to a case studies format Students analyze and discuss real-life operational case studies from various health care organizations.
Supervised field work in clinical operations and health management, arranged in consultation with the program director. May be repeated for credit.
The cross-cutting nature of the social determinants of health and clinical and biomedical implications in practice and research settings. This is the prerequisite course to begin the health equity micro-minor.
Basic issues, approaches, and requirements of ethically acceptable decision making with patients, including patient confidentiality, conflicts of interest, allocation of scarce resources, occupational risks in health care, and professional responsibility for overall quality of care.
New technologies, healthcare delivery models, and the phenomenon of sophisticated consumers. Assessment of the impact of science, technology, ethics, and government on the provision of healthcare.
Incorporates economic theory and policy analysis methodology to analyze the impact of changes in the health care system on the practice of health sciences professionals and the quality and process of health care. Development of critical thinking skills through review of current medical literature.
Application of management and organizational principles to the delivery of services provided by health sciences disciplines Issues addressed include information systems, leadership, team building, fiscal management, human resources management, quality improvement, and management of conflict and change.
Analysis of the structures in place to enhance the quality of health care delivery and political and economic influences that affect quality improvement programs. Assessment of specific interventions to enhance health care from the perspectives of providers and patients.
This is an upper division course intended to introduce students to the legal structures, rules, and mechanisms important to health care professionals, executives and organizations. Students analyze a range of legal standards related to medical malpractice and liability, fraud and abuse, and health care compliance. Since this is a health sciences course, trends in genetics, pharmacy law, and laboratory law will be discussed. In addition, students will become familiar with key legal terms, documents, and sources of law; the tools of communication and governance that shape health care arrangements and practices.
An introduction to epidemiological methods and their applications in the prevention and control of illness, community and clinical interventions, and health services.
Medical informatics applications and innovations in health care and the health care system; implications for health care delivery and patient outcomes, including electronic medical records, health system databases, and medical data analysis.
Introduction to the field of regulatory affairs to regulations, strategies, and laws that apply to safe and effective product development.
MSHS
An overview of the US health care system and the influence of health policy development and implementation on health care quality. Introduction to fundamental concepts of health care quality, patient safety, leadership, and change management. Applicants of the MSHS in Health Care Quality program may use the Certified Professional in Healthcare Quality (CPHQ) credential as an accepted equivalent.
Covers the analysis of quality and patient safety challenges in U.S. health care with a focus on political and environmental influences.

Analysis of the structures in place to enhance the quality of health care delivery and political and economic influences that affect quality improvement programs. Assessment of specific interventions to enhance health care from the perspectives of providers and patients.
Involves application of measurement, data management and statistical analysis principles to quality improvement and patient safety challenges. This course focuses on the importance and design of effective measures and the selection of appropriate analysis tools.
Involves an examination of the epidemiology and sources of error in health care, risk assessment and the design of processes and systems to improve patient safety Focuses on the application of process and technology-based systems to reduce the incidence of error.
Approaches to medical informatics to support managerial decision making, patient care, and quality improvement in clinical practices. Ethical, legal, and social dimensions of health care information technology.
Designed for the student to integrate all of the material from the HCQ program of study in a master’s level proposal for a research projects intended to address a major area of a change within health care quality and/or clinical research. The course includes a series of case studies for which the students evaluate and develop strategic alternatives. The final project is designed to have the student develop a proposal similar to chapter one of a research proposal that can then be pursued after graduation or through a doctoral level program.
Overview of principles related to leadership, including theories and styles, organizational management and values, communication strategies, and change in the context of health care systems. Credit cannot be earned for this course, and HSCI 6223.
Overview of business principles related to health care systems and leadership, focusing on strategic management of health care service delivery in various settings. Credit cannot be earned for this course and HSCI 6241.
Basic concepts and methods of biostatistics applied to translational research. Topics include distributions, populations and sample selection, variables, interaction and confounding, hypothesis formulation, correlation, t-tests, ANOVA, regression, and chi.
Students explore the basic concepts of epidemiology which includes various epidemiological study designs used to examine disease frequency, cause-effect relationships between risk factors and disease states, and effects of bias as examples. Students apply epidemiologic concepts in the context of translational research.
